CC -!- FUNCTION: Accelerates the degradation of transcripts by removing
CC pyrophosphate from the 5'-end of triphosphorylated RNA, leading to a
CC more labile monophosphorylated state that can stimulate subsequent
CC ribonuclease cleavage. {ECO:0000255|HAMAP-Rule:MF_00298}.
